Propranolol is more effective than pulsed dye laser and cryosurgery for infantile hemangiomas
Shinji Kagami1, Yoshihiro Kuwano, Sayaka Shibata
1Department of Dermatology, Faculty of Medicine, University of Tokyo, Tokyo, Japan, kagamis-tky@umin.ac.jp.
Insights
Propranolol offers a superior, safe treatment for infantile hemangiomas compared to traditional methods. Early propranolol intervention significantly reduces hemangioma size and redness with minimal side effects.
Area of Science:
- Pediatric Dermatology
- Pharmacology
- Vascular Anomalies
Background:
- Infantile hemangiomas are common benign vascular tumors in infants.
- Traditional treatments like laser and cryosurgery have limitations.
- Propranolol, a nonselective beta-blocker, shows promise for hemangioma treatment.
Purpose of the Study:
- To compare the efficacy of propranolol versus conventional therapies for infantile hemangiomas.
- To evaluate propranolol's safety profile in infants with hemangiomas.
Main Methods:
- Prospective study comparing propranolol (2 mg/kg/day) to pulsed dye laser/cryosurgery.
- Involved 15 infants treated with propranolol and 12 controls.
- Monitored infants via ECG, echocardiogram, chest X-ray, and regular vital sign checks.
Main Results:
- Propranolol demonstrated significantly faster involution and reduced redness.
- No adverse events like hypoglycemia, hypotension, or bradycardia were observed.
- Blinded volume measurements and photographs confirmed propranolol's superior efficacy.
Conclusions:
- Propranolol is highly effective with a favorable safety profile for infantile hemangiomas.
- Early treatment with propranolol may decrease disfigurement.
- Propranolol should be considered a first-line therapy for infantile hemangiomas.
Unlabelled:
Propranolol hydrochloride is a nonselective β-blocker that is used for the treatment of hypertension, arrhythmia, and angina pectoris. In Japan, it was recently approved for the treatment of childhood arrhythmia. It has been observed to produce drastic involution of infantile hemangiomas. The aim of this prospective study was to examine propranolol's superiority to classical therapy with pulsed dye laser and/or cryosurgery in treating proliferating infantile hemangiomas. Fifteen patients between the ages of 1 and 4 months with proliferating infantile hemangiomas received grinded propranolol tablets 2 mg/kg per day divided in three doses. Twelve patients with proliferating infantile hemangiomas receiving pulsed dye laser and/or cryosurgery were enrolled as controls. Baseline electrocardiogram, echocardiogram, and chest x-ray were performed. Monitoring of heart rate, blood pressure, and blood glucose was performed every 2 weeks. Efficacy was assessed by performing blinded volume measurements and taking photographs at every visit. Propranolol induced significantly earlier involution and redness reduction of infantile hemangiomas, compared to pulsed dye laser and cryosurgery. Adverse effects such as hypoglycemia, hypotension, or bradycardia did not occur.
Conclusion:
The dramatic response of infantile hemangiomas to propranolol and few side effects suggest that early treatment of infantile hemangiomas could result in decreased disfigurement. Propranolol should be considered as a first-line treatment of infantile hemangiomas.
